Are there some compromises with the Cybertruck design? Absolutely.

It may be difficult to judge the front end when parking, owners will need to rely on the rear view mirror camera to see out the back, front quarter window area may have large blind spots, the football field dashboard may have an issue with reflections in the windshield, the bedsides are very sloped, the interior is as spartan as Tesla designers could make it (cheap to manufacture), etc.
